Ngoko ke indlela yokwahlula umgangatho wezibane zokutshiza ze-LED xa uthenga? Umahluko wedatha yesibiyeli yesibane: Okwangoku, kukho izibiyeli ze-aluminiyam, izibiyeli zobhedu, kunye nezibiyeli zobhedu kwimarike. Ixabiso ngamaxesha amaninzi umgama. Nokuba isibiyeli sobhedu, ixabiso lesilivere liya kwahlulwa libe liphezulu neliphantsi. Imarike idla ngokubizwa ngokuba sisibiyeli esilungileyo. Uninzi lwazo lwenziwe ngesilivere yobhedu. Ukwahlula kwedatha yomgca we-welding: I-chip kunye ne-bracket isetyenziselwa ukugqiba uxhulumaniso lwe-electrode kunye nenkqubo yegolide ye-welding. Okwangoku, kukho iindidi ezimbini zemigca yealloyi kunye neengcingo zegolide ezisulungekileyo kwimarike. Umgca wegolide ecocekileyo ulungile. I-Optoelectronics isebenzisa imigca yegolide esulungekileyo ngokobunzima kwaye yahlulwe yaba yi-0.7, 0.9, 1.0, 1.2, njl. Ubuninzi bomgca wegolide, iqela le-thermal lisezantsi, ubude bobomi. Umahluko wesayizi yetshiphu: Isayizi yetshiphu edla ngokuxelwa yi-MIL. Ukuba akukho makroskopu yokulinganisa amandla aphezulu, akukho ndlela yokwahlula. Sinokuthelekisa ubungakanani be-chip ngokubala indawo ye-chip, efana ne-23X10, indawo ye-chip yi-230 square MIL, kwaye indawo ye-chip yahlulwe ibe yi-chip size. Iinkcazo zokwahlula kombala, ukwahlukana kunye nokwahlula: (1) ulwahlulo lombala: luluhlu lobushushu bombala, olufana ne-3200k-3350K yigiya. Umzi-mveliso wokupakisha oqhelekileyo uya kubonelela ngekhowudi ye-BIN yokushisa kombala. Incinci indawo yobushushu bombala, ngcono, iqondo lokushisa lombala Igiya elincinci, umbala wemithombo yokukhanya ulungile. (2) Umbane ohlukileyo: Yisixhobo sombane se-chip, esifana ne-3.0V-3.15V. Kuba umthombo wokukhanya yindlela yokudibanisa edibeneyo, i-voltage ilawulwa ngaphakathi kwe-0.15V. Ubomi. (3) Unyango: Ukukhanya kweentsimbi zesibane kwahlulwe, kwaye kukho i-lumens okanye izitali okanye ukukhanya okukhanyayo. Kucetyiswa ukuba uthenge iintsimbi zesibane sesibane se-LED, okanye ngokusekelwe ekusebenzeni kokukhanya. Umahluko phakathi komgubo we-fluorescence: amaso okukhanya amhlophe enziwe nge-blue-light chip kunye nomgubo we-fluorescent omthubi. Umgubo we-fluorescent uhlukaniswe kakhulu kwi-asidi ye-aluminium kunye ne-silicate. Ukusebenza kwe-aluminate kungcono kune-silicate. Iasidi yeAluminiyam imelwe yiYAG. I-YAG inomsebenzi ozinzileyo, ukubola kokukhanya okuphantsi, kunye nozinzo olubi lwekhemikhali ye-silicate ngokwayo, kodwa ukukhanya kuphezulu kune-YAG. Iimveliso azinakukhohliswa yinto ebizwa ngokuba yi-lightness high pit. Le yingxaki enkulu. Umahluko phakathi kweglue: Umgubo we-fluorescent kufuneka uxutywe ngeglue kunye ne-chip. Iingenelo kunye nokungalunganga kweglue kuya kuchaphazela ukubola kokukhanya kunye nokukhukuliseka kombala. Ixesha elibi leglue liya kuba liphuzi, kwaye ukubola kokukhanya kuya kwanda. Iglu elungileyo yijeli. Glue. I-LED chip electrode diagram: Ukuba umenzi we-chip wahlukile, umgangatho we-LED uhlukile. Abavelisi be-LED baya kuchaza ukuba luhlobo luni lokupakishwa kwe-chip yeentsimbi zayo zesibane sesibane se-LED. Umenzi unokuyibona ngaphandle kokuba i-chip yokuxobula ihlolwe phantsi kwe-microscope yamandla aphezulu. Okokugqibela, makhe sijonge iiparamitha ezifanelekileyo ze-3528LED amaso isibane, 3528 Guqula ukukhanya okumhlophe: ubushushu obufudumeleyo obumhlophe: 2800-3200K, ukukhanya okumhlophe kweZheng (ubushushu obumhlophe obubandayo): 6000-9000K-15000K ngasentla. I-3528 Guqula ukukhanya okubomvu: ubude be-wavelength eqhelekileyo: 620-630nm, i-voltage: 1.9-2.2V, amandla 0.06W, okwangoku: 20mA. I-3528 ukukhanya kwe-Orange: ubude obuqhelekileyo: 600-610nm, i-voltage: 1.9-2.2V, amandla 0.06W, okwangoku: 20mA. I-3528 ukukhanya okuphuzi: ubude obuqhelekileyo: 585-595nm, i-voltage: 1.9-2.2V, amandla 0.06W, okwangoku: 20mA. I-3528 i-Emerald eluhlaza: ubude obuqhelekileyo: 515-525nm, i-voltage: 3.0-3.3V, amandla 0.06W, okwangoku: 20mA. I-3528 eluhlaza okwesibhakabhaka: ubude obuqhelekileyo: 565-575nm, i-voltage: 1.9-2.2V, amandla 0.06W, okwangoku: 20mA. I-3528 inwele ukukhanya okuluhlaza: ubude be-wavelength: 460-470nm, i-voltage: 3.0-3.3V, amandla 0.06W, okwangoku: 20mA. 3528 Thumela ukukhanya okumfusa: ubude obuqhelekileyo: 395-410nm, i-voltage: 3.0-3.3V, amandla 0.06W, okwangoku: 20mA. I-3528 Pinki: I-Voltage: 3.0-3.3V, amandla 0.06W, okwangoku: 20mA. (Jonga iinkcukacha zezinye iiparamitha ezineenkcukacha).
